Гость
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Ошибка ORA-12505 / 10 сообщений из 10, страница 1 из 1
27.04.2020, 14:04
    #39951958
Diana1999998
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Ошибка ORA-12505
При попытке приконнектиться к базе oracle, выдается сообщение:
ORA-12505 TNS:listener could not resolve SID diven in
listener.ora
Код: plsql
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
22.
23.
24.
25.
# listener.ora Network Configuration File: D:\ora\NETWORK\ADMIN\listener.ora
# Generated by Oracle configuration tools.

SID_LIST_LISTENER =
  (SID_LIST =
    (SID_DESC =
      (SID_NAME = CLRExtProc)
      (ORACLE_HOME = D:\ora)
      (PROGRAM = extproc)
      (ENVS = "EXTPROC_DLLS=ONLY:D:\ora\bin\oraclr18.dll")
    )
(SID_DESC =
(GLOBAL_DBNAME= ORCL)
(ORACLE_HOME = D:\ora)
(SID_NAME=ORCL)
)
)

LISTENER =
  (DESCRIPTION_LIST =
    (DESCRIPTION =
      (ADDRESS = (PROTOCOL = TCP)(HOST = localhost)(PORT = 1521))
      (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1521))
    )
  )


tnsnames.ora
Код: plsql
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
# tnsnames.ora Network Configuration File: D:\ora\NETWORK\ADMIN\tnsnames.ora
# Generated by Oracle configuration tools.
LISTENER_ORCLE=
(ADDRESS = (PROTOCOL = TPC)(HOST = localhost)(PORT=1521))

ORCL=
(DESCRIPTION =
(ADDRESS_LIST =
      (ADDRESS = (PROTOCOL = TPC)(HOST = localhost)(PORT=1521))
)
      (CONNECT_DATA =
      (SID = ORCL)
    )
    )


Помогите пожалуйста разобраться!
...
Рейтинг: 0 / 0
27.04.2020, 14:11
    #39951963
dmdmdm
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Ошибка ORA-12505
Дайте полностью команду подсоединения к базе.
И результат команды lsnrctl services.
...
Рейтинг: 0 / 0
27.04.2020, 14:12
    #39951964
tru55
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Ошибка ORA-12505
У тебя в listener.ora все описание твоей БД начинается с 1-й позиции, как приведено в посте?
...
Рейтинг: 0 / 0
27.04.2020, 14:22
    #39951969
SQL*Plus
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Ошибка ORA-12505
Название темы было бы намного лучше, если было бы таким:
Ошибка ORA-12505: TNS:listener does not currently know of SID given in connect descriptor

То есть лучше написать не только номер ошибки, но и её текст.
Так вашим читателям будет удобнее.
...
Рейтинг: 0 / 0
27.04.2020, 14:23
    #39951971
dmdmdm
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Ошибка ORA-12505
PROTOCOL = TPC

Поначалу лучше использовать Net Configuraion Assistant.
Если вручную правите, в начале всех строк, кроме первой, должен быть хотя один пробел.

Код: powershell
1.
2.
3.
4.
5.
6.
7.
8.
9.
ORCL=
 (DESCRIPTION =
 (ADDRESS_LIST =
      (ADDRESS = (PROTOCOL = TPC)(HOST = 192.168.1.201)(PORT=1521))
 )
      (CONNECT_DATA =
      (SID = ORCL)
    )
    )



ORA-12505 TNS:listener could not resolve SID d iven in

Возьмите за правило делать Ctrl+C / Ctrl +V.
...
Рейтинг: 0 / 0
27.04.2020, 14:23
    #39951973
Diana1999998
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Ошибка ORA-12505
dmdmdm,
...
Рейтинг: 0 / 0
27.04.2020, 14:25
    #39951974
SQL*Plus
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Ошибка ORA-12505
dmdmdm
Дайте полностью команду подсоединения к базе.
И результат команды lsnrctl services.

+ результат команды
Код: plaintext
lsnrctl status

Команду lsnrctl нужно выполнять на сервере.
...
Рейтинг: 0 / 0
27.04.2020, 14:25
    #39951976
tru55
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Ошибка ORA-12505
Diana1999998,
Что и требовалось доказать. Listener не воспринимает описание твоей БД в listener.ora
...
Рейтинг: 0 / 0
28.04.2020, 12:49
    #39952322
andrey_anonymous
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Ошибка ORA-12505
dmdmdm
PROTOCOL = TPC

Поначалу лучше использовать Net Configuraion Assistant.


Diana1999998

Код: plsql
1.
2.
# listener.ora Network Configuration File: D:\ora\NETWORK\ADMIN\listener.ora
# Generated by Oracle configuration tools.



Diana1999998, обратите внимание на misstype:
Diana1999998

Код: plsql
1.
2.
3.
4.
5.
6.
7.
LISTENER_ORCLE=
(ADDRESS = (PROTOCOL = TPC)(HOST = localhost)(PORT=1521))

ORCL=
(DESCRIPTION =
(ADDRESS_LIST =
      (ADDRESS = (PROTOCOL = TPC)(HOST = localhost)(PORT=1521))




Следующий вопрос - экземпляр-то стартовал?
Покажите вывод lsnrctl services
...
Рейтинг: 0 / 0
29.04.2020, 08:42
    #39952692
SAS2014
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Ошибка ORA-12505
можно просто пересоздать настройки листнера и тнс нейймса с верными данными
...
Рейтинг: 0 / 0
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Ошибка ORA-12505 / 10 сообщений из 10, страница 1 из 1
Целевая тема:
Создать новую тему:
Автор:
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]